主编推荐语
这是一本从源代码角度剖析Flink设计思想、架构原理以及各功能模块的底层实现原理的著作。
内容简介
全书共8章: 第1章介绍Flink设计理念与基本架构; 第2章介绍DataStream的设计与实现; 第3章介绍运行时的核心原理与实现,包括Dispatcher、ResourceManager以及JobManager等核心组件的源码级解析和介绍; 第4章介绍Flink任务提交与执行的整体流程,包括客户端实现、运行时作业执行过程、JobGraph及ExecutionGraph图转换等; 第5章介绍不同的集群部署模式,包括On Yarn、On Kubernetes等; 第6章介绍状态管理与容错,包括不同类型状态后端的设计与实现; 第7章介绍Flink网络通信,包括RPC通信以及基于Netty实现的网络栈; 第8章介绍Flink内存管理,包括MemorySegment的设计与实现等。
出版方
机械工业出版社有限公司